Output 6b51d3b69ca58e6ccd812b8f999d074d60cfdd826d22253f77a0e4dd6aca08db:1

value
58392623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b71d8440508bbff8ede34a44528cb53275668ab0 OP_EQUAL
address
3JPEwVs9ySZWXHtChkB9nEaFhhYXV9MLqT
transaction
6b51d3b69ca58e6ccd812b8f999d074d60cfdd826d22253f77a0e4dd6aca08db
confirmations
343995
spent
true